A Planet Antares soda vending machine is manufactured on several automated, simultaneously running assembly lines. Galvanized steel is used to create the cabinet. The raw steel passes through automated presses at the beginning of assembly line to make the sheet rolls flat and cut it out. Two or more pieces of steel are used to make the cabinets. After that, the sheets will have to be punched and notched. This process results in creation of:

• Holes in the cabinets for fasteners and bolts
• Slits for vents
• Openings for electrical cords

To accommodate the fitting of components, the corners and edges of the steel sheets will be fixed on to the cabinet of the Planet Antares vending machine. Sheets of steel will pass through heavy duty air and hydraulic presses automatically. Bends can be created in the metal to crimp the edges by using the hydraulic presses. The seams can be secured with the help of resistance or spot welding. The final step is to give powder finishing to the cabinet and install the tank.

While the cabinet is being prepared, the tank will also be formed using a similar process by another line of staff. To fit the tank into the cabinet, mechanisms are punched into the sheets and the corners are notched. The necessary bending is done by presses and this is followed by welding together of these pieces to form a unit.

An eight stage pre treatment is undertaken before applying the powder coating. The surface of the cabinet is cleaned with an alkaline bath and then rinsed before getting a zinc phosphate coating. Then, the rinsing part is repeated. After some time, a chromic acid is applied and the cabinet is rinsed again in deionized water. Next, the units will be placed in a drying oven to be followed by powder finish coating.

This will be followed by combining for the units and cabinets for undertaking foaming and applying polyurethane foam insulation inside the vending machine. After this, the tank will be fitted inside the cabinet and pre-heated till it takes form. After completion of this stage, the refrigeration units are installed in the bottom of the cabinet.

The vending machine customers can only gain access to the products through the door of the machine. so, this is an important component of the machine. The basic door shell is made and finished in the same way as described above for cabinets and tanks. However, there is one additional punching needed to accommodate the controls on the doors. Door assembly takes place in a single area instead of an assembly line because the correct door should fit into the correct cabinet. There must be minimal possible errors during this process for effective vending machine operations.
